Business travels have provided me with some really interesting food options.  In this category, it would probably be some sort of sheep soup with eyeballs, and also a plate of chicken feet.  Most weird that I didn't eat was Soft-Boiled Fetal Duck that I was offered in Asia (no thanks).

Most gross tasting was boiled beef tripe in Italy (straight up, "senza niente"). Smell alone made me want to up-chuck in the company cafe.

I spent a couple years in Thailand and I ate some kind of weird stuff there. Dog is completely acceptable to eat over there and actually tastes pretty good. Of course I had the fried insects - scorpion, grasshoppers, worms, etc. I actually enjoyed the fermented fish (plaa raa) they put in the food in the eastern part of the country. We had grilled field mice on a skewer and some boiled blood soup stuff, it looks like really dark red jello. I figured I would try everything once, and ended up liking a lot of it!!

Here in Arizona they have cow tongue tacos and tacos de cabeza (head meat tacos) at the more "authentic" restaurants. I enjoy trying different types of food. My mom always told me, "don't knock it 'til ya tried it!"
